  • Patent number: 8801575
    Abstract: A powered vehicular interlock system includes a powered vehicle with a propulsion means, a final drive means, a braking means, and a vehicle operator's chamber having a floor and a seat. The system includes an automatic transmission, a braking activation interface located close to the floor on the floor first side section, and a propulsion activation interface located close to the floor on a floor second side section. The system includes a propulsion deactivation interlock system having a braking activation sensor, a deactivation module, and a power supply. In a first position, the propulsion deactivation interlock system is adapted to allow the powered vehicle to be propelled. For operation, upon activation of the braking activation interface to a second position, the propulsion deactivation interlock system adapted to prohibit the powered vehicle from being propelled.

  • Patent number: 8308613
    Abstract: A combination brake pedal and an accelerator pedal assembly allowing the vehicle to be driven with both feet comprising a brake and an accelerator, the accelerator being operatively connected to an engine control lever that moves between an engaged and a disengaged position, when the accelerator is pressed the engine control lever moves to the engaged position to accelerate the vehicle, when the accelerator is not pressed the engine control lever moves to the disengaged position so the vehicle does not accelerate; and an accelerator pedal disengagement device operatively connected to the brake and accelerator for moving the engine control lever to the disengaged position when the brake pedal is pushed, wherein the accelerator pedal disengagement device prevents the accelerator pedal from causing the engine control lever to move to the engaged position when both the accelerator pedal and brake pedal are pressed.

  • Patent number: 5072615
    Abstract: A vehicle fuel tank gauging apparatus is disclosed comprising sensor means for measuring the amount of fuel in the tank, electronic memory means for storing a signal indicative of the amount, inclinometer means for detecting whether the vehicle is level, and a microprocessor which allow the fuel amount signal to be transmitted to a fuel gauge when the vehicle is level within a predetermined tolerance. The fuel level information is stored in the memory of the microprocessor and displayed on the fuel gauge only when the vehicle attains the next level condition. Thus, the fuel gauge reading is not effected by vehicle tilt or acceleration. Alternatively, the degree to which the vehicle is askew to the reference plane is measured, and a correction factor corresponding to the degree of tilt is applied to the fuel amount signal to calculate a corrected fuel amount signal.
